如何获取查询语句作为输出?如果我在 php 中传递这个语句$studentTableUpdater= DB::table($session) ->where("rollNo", '=', $rollNo, 'AND', "name", '=', $name) ->update(['roomNo' => $migrateRoom]);我可以得到输出语句为“0 行受影响。(查询耗时 0.0031 秒。)
1 回答
慕工程0101907
TA贡献1887条经验 获得超5个赞
您可以启用查询日志,例如:
DB::enableQueryLog();
$studentTableUpdater = DB::table($session)
->where("rollNo", '=', $rollNo, 'AND', "name", '=', $name)
->update(['roomNo' => $migrateRoom]);
$query = DB::getQueryLog());
dd($query)
- 1 回答
- 0 关注
- 111 浏览
添加回答
举报
0/150
提交
取消